The Great Hole Spacing Debate: What’s the Answer?

Alright, here’s the deal. When dentists punch holes in a dental dam, they need to be spaced correctly, typically 3 mm apart. But why 3 mm? Let's explore that.

A Closer Look at the Functionality

Picture this: the dental dam is stretched over the teeth to isolate the specific area the dentist is working on. It's not just there for the aesthetics or to make the procedure look high-tech. Nope! This bad boy is crucial for moisture control and keeping the operative field clean. If the holes are too close together, the dam might not provide enough tension to stay in place effectively. Too far apart, and you risk the dam leaving gaps that can lead to saliva contamination. Yikes! Who wants extra saliva when they’re already in a dental chair?

So, by placing those holes at a comfortable 3 mm apart, dental practitioners are striking a balance between secure fit and patient comfort. Does that sound like design perfection? It does to me!

Why Spacing Matters: The Science Behind It

The spacing of those holes isn’t just a haphazard choice—it’s science. With 3 mm between the holes, the dam maintains adequate tension, which is vital for a couple of reasons. First, it ensures the dam fits snugly around the teeth without pushing or pinching the gums. Who wants to feel uncomfortable during what is already a sensitive procedure? No one, I tell you!

Moreover, with this spacing, the dental dam creates a better seal around the treated area. This means saliva stays where it belongs—in your mouth— rather than dripping right into the surgical field. You can see that this little detail helps the dentist stay focused on the task at hand, without interruption from a puddle of saliva. It's a win-win!
